Eligibility rules for extracurricular activities

Extracurricular activities include drama, plays, clubs, student council and athletics.  We have a very large portion of our student population that takes advantage of the many activities, choir, art, athletics, school newspaper, yearbook band, music, drama & library.

After report cards or progress reports are issued and released to the parents first, then the report goes to activity moderators. The child will be contacted the following week to review the school policy on participation as well as to discuss ways to improve performance .

ELIGIBILITY FOR EXTRACURRICULAR PROGRAM

It is a firm belief that participation in extracurricular programs contributes to the total development of he students at SS. Cyrill & Methodius School. Students gain many positive benefits from these programs, and are encouraged to become involved in these programs. However, it must be made clear to students
that participation in extracurricular activities is a privilege and can be taken away if certain conditions are not met.

In an effort to help students maintain a balance between extracurricular involvement and the academic Program, we have established the following criteria.

In order to participate in extracurricular programs, students are expected to meet the following minimum standards for eligibility:

  1. Academic average must be compatible with the student's ability level.

  2. Appropriate conduct must be maintained. Persistent and/or serious misbehavior and disrespect will result in suspension from extracurricular programs.

Guidelines

  1. Students' progress will be reviewed at the time progress reports and report cards are issued.

  2. Students receiving a deficiency notice for academic or behavior categories in two or more subjects, will be considered ineligible for participation in extracurricular activities for a minimum of one week.

    Student athletes must go to practice, but may not participate in actual games, Restriction of practice may be made by the principal, coach, or parent if necessary. If satisfactory academic progress or consistent proper behavior improves after the one-week probation period, the student nay return to the program.

  3. These students will be reviewed every two weeks to insure that progress is maintained.

  4. After thee temporary suspensions, if academic progress or proper behavior is not maintained, the student will be considered permanently removed from the program for the current school year.

  5. Adults responsible for extracurricular activities, i.e. moderators, coaches, etc. will be notified of the ineligibility status by the principal and/or Athletic Commission President.

  6. There may be circumstances that warrant immediate probation, or suspension from the extracurricular program.
